Skip to content

Releases: spinnaker/fiat

fiat v1.25.0

01 Oct 17:13
fde193e
Compare
Choose a tag to compare

fde193e chore(build): Bump to kork 7.74.0 (#789)
84d8c99 chore(dependencies): Autobump korkVersion (#787)
9bb1613 chore(dependencies): Autobump spinnakerGradleVersion (#786)

fiat v1.24.0

25 Sep 22:14
f2bc5c6
Compare
Choose a tag to compare

f2bc5c6 fix(errors): Import kork-web ErrorConfiguration into fiat-api configuration, wire up FiatAccessDeniedExceptionHandler (#785)
ddab7db chore(dependencies): Autobump korkVersion (#784)
ea55b70 feat(extensibility): Add UserMessageService in FiatAccessDeniedExceptionHandler to provide optional custom messages to end-users on access denied exceptions (#781)
eb541ff chore(dependencies): Autobump korkVersion (#783)
347296f Revert "perf(auth/ldap): Limit search object size (#747)" (#778)
284ee77 chore(dependencies): Autobump korkVersion (#780)
3f5379f chore(dependencies): Autobump spinnakerGradleVersion (#779)
f4857ab chore(dependencies): Autobump korkVersion (#776)
056ad71 chore(dependencies): Autobump korkVersion (#775)
258969e chore(dependencies): Autobump korkVersion (#774)
6d76e12 fix(google): Retrieve all the groups for a user (#755)
6cbb85f chore(dependencies): Autobump korkVersion (#773)
40cb045 chore(dependencies): Autobump korkVersion (#772)
b5e7279 chore(java11): Target Java 11. (#771)
6011f28 chore(dependencies): Autobump spinnakerGradleVersion (#770)
9bfa0fd fix(redis): fix accidental change of default redis key prefix (#769)

fiat v1.23.0

09 Sep 03:26
6aeed13
Compare
Choose a tag to compare

6aeed13 feat(api): allow fiat clients to check if there is a user permission cached (#768)
2050fc5 fix(perms): adds fallback for fetching unrestricted user (#767)
a51a845 fix(test): slightly more legit concurrency primitives for flakey test (#766)
bdb09ab perf(auth/ldap): Limit search object size (#747)
ca87f8b fix(test): add slightly longer sleep time to poorly concurrent test (#765)
a505a79 fix(repo): don't swallow exceptions in PermissionRepository.get (#764)
78edd94 chore(dependencies): Autobump korkVersion (#763)
6741941 chore(dependencies): Autobump korkVersion (#762)
9c648a2 chore(dependencies): Autobump korkVersion (#761)
262c750 chore(dependencies): Autobump korkVersion (#760)
46a2f47 chore(build): gradle 6.6.1 (#759)
96d6a17 chore(dependencies): Autobump korkVersion (#757)
b421b06 feat(metrics): instrument PermissionRepository (#758)
61f1e36 feat(perf): cache the unrestricted users permissions (#751)
edea932 chore(dependencies): Autobump korkVersion (#756)
969d95f chore(dependencies): Autobump korkVersion (#754)
fbca729 chore(dependencies): Autobump korkVersion (#753)
9f26971 chore(dependencies): Autobump korkVersion (#752)
0ac386f fix(authorize): fixes for authorize redis and fallback (#750)
d0c756f chore(dependencies): Autobump korkVersion (#749)
0e4b470 chore(build): gradle 6.6 (#748)
0057cc6 chore(dependencies): Autobump spinnakerGradleVersion (#746)
a6eda9c chore(dockerfile): various Dockerfile cleanups (#745)
9442ea4 chore(dependencies): Autobump korkVersion (#744)
c90eb68 chore(dependencies): Autobump korkVersion (#743)
249c05c chore(dependencies): Autobump korkVersion (#742)
e2a09da feat(fiat): Add support for Redis SSL (#741)
9596559 chore(spotless): upgrade spinnaker gradle plugin (#740)
cc55873 chore(dependencies): Autobump korkVersion (#739)
af3207b chore(dependencies): Autobump korkVersion (#738)
aa6c9a6 chore(dependencies): Autobump korkVersion (#737)
531b551 chore(dependencies): Autobump korkVersion (#736)
d9d0cd8 chore(dependencies): Autobump korkVersion (#735)
9a390dc chore(dependencies): Autobump korkVersion (#733)

fiat v1.22.0

10 Jul 19:31
b60d8dc
Compare
Choose a tag to compare

b60d8dc feat(discovery): refactor to use common discovery abstraction from kork-core (#734)
4a617eb chore(dependencies): replace kork dependencies with kork-runtime (#731)
d26892c chore(dependencies): Autobump korkVersion (#732)
e527dc1 chore(dependencies): Autobump korkVersion (#730)
062d42a chore(dependencies): Autobump korkVersion (#729)
ff9171f chore(dependencies): Autobump korkVersion (#728)
521cbd4 chore(dependencies): Autobump korkVersion (#727)
bc22346 chore(dependencies): Autobump spinnakerGradleVersion (#726)
6f42644 chore(build): gradle 6.5.1 (#725)
997091c chore(dependencies): Autobump korkVersion (#724)
2574263 chore(doc): add missing userrole provider (#723)
fbd1b08 fix(docs): Update broken link (#721)
918ab04 chore(dependencies): Autobump korkVersion (#720)

fiat v1.21.0

24 Jun 18:32
7906b20
Compare
Choose a tag to compare

7906b20 chore(dependencies): Autobump korkVersion (#719)
147cfda chore(dependencies): Autobump spinnakerGradleVersion (#718)
092df3f chore(build): gradle 6.5 (#717)
daf58f5 feat(resources): add support for extension resources (#712)
12bea89 chore(dependencies): Autobump korkVersion (#716)
ae7305d chore(dependencies): Autobump korkVersion (#715)
b3d45e9 chore(dependencies): Autobump korkVersion (#714)
be5b921 chore(dependencies): Autobump korkVersion (#713)
e770a53 chore(dependencies): Autobump korkVersion (#711)
1edd71a chore(dependencies): Autobump korkVersion (#710)
d298c94 chore(dependencies): Autobump korkVersion (#709)
651358e chore(dependencies): Autobump korkVersion (#708)
efcf5fd chore(dependencies): Autobump korkVersion (#707)
3ab185c chore(dependencies): Autobump korkVersion (#706)
8ee0522 chore(dependencies): Autobump korkVersion (#705)
9330896 chore(dependencies): Autobump korkVersion (#704)

fiat v1.20.0

15 Jun 18:31
e35407c
Compare
Choose a tag to compare

e35407c chore(dependencies): Autobump korkVersion (#703)
62f3a98 chore(dependencies): Autobump korkVersion (#702)
d792284 chore(dependencies): Autobump korkVersion (#701)
15c4aa9 chore(dependencies): Autobump korkVersion (#700)
ddba619 chore(dependencies): Autobump korkVersion (#699)
b2b8ba5 chore(dependencies): Autobump korkVersion (#698)
4c0dd99 chore(dependencies): Autobump korkVersion (#697)
8eb9486 chore(dependencies): Autobump korkVersion (#696)
09bf41c chore(dependencies): Autobump korkVersion (#695)
14048f7 chore(dependencies): Autobump korkVersion (#694)
9393268 chore(dependencies): Autobump korkVersion (#693)
c7b9e99 fix(misc): Move to client provider impl for spinnaker internal services (#690)
4a5ee9e chore(dependencies): Autobump spinnakerGradleVersion (#692)
9dd58e6 chore(build): gradle 6.4.1 (#691)
c722764 chore(dynomite): Remove dynomite from project (#688)

fiat v1.19.1

20 May 17:22
4c9aa59
Compare
Choose a tag to compare

4c9aa59 chore(user): support UserDetails interface instead of User object (#687)
ee97bce chore(dependencies): Autobump korkVersion (#689)
2367055 chore(dependencies): Autobump korkVersion (#686)

fiat v1.19.0

14 May 19:55
e3c7a66
Compare
Choose a tag to compare

1690430 chore(dependencies): Autobump korkVersion (#685)
eac2cf6 fix(serviceAccounts): limit the number of service accounts to expand (#683)
e3c7a66 config(core): Move redis connection default to base config (#679)

This release includes a change to where fiat will look for the redis connection string if it is not explicitly specified in the redis.connection config property. Prior to this release, the redis connection would be the first non-empty value from:

  • redis.connection
  • services.redis.connection
  • redis://localhost:6379

After this release, redis connection will be the first non-empty value from:

  • redis.connection
  • services.redis.baseUrl
  • redis://localhost:6379

This means that if you were not specifying redis.connection explicitly, and were relying on a value set in services.redis.connection, you will need to update your config to specify your redis connection in either redis.connection or services.redis.baseUrl. This change was made so that configuring redis for fiat` is consistent with how it is configured for other services.

fiat v1.18.6

13 May 21:14
8fa8bdb
Compare
Choose a tag to compare

8fa8bdb fix(misc): Use new client provider and remove usage of deprecated OkHttpClientConfiguration (#682)
3ea1a68 chore(dependencies): Autobump korkVersion (#684)
8e721b8 chore(dependencies): Autobump korkVersion (#681)
81279b4 chore(dependencies): Autobump korkVersion (#680)

fiat v1.18.5

08 May 00:20
e638e6b
Compare
Choose a tag to compare

e638e6b fix(api): remove spring-boot-properties-migrator from fiat-api (#678)